// REINDEX_BATCH_CAP limits docs per shard pass in the Tallowfield
// nightly search reindex. Raising it starves the ingest queue;
// lowering it overruns the maintenance window. 5000 is the tested
// sweet spot. Change only with a soak run. Verified against the
// build noted below.

session token of bawif-hahog = htk6_ac5981

We will enable adaptive sampling at the agent level: full capture for error and warning levels, one-in-fifty sampling for debug and info during surge conditions. On-call should verify the sampling flag after each deploy, since the agent config has reverted twice before. The verification steps and rollback procedure are written up on the page below.

dashboard of bafof-hafog = https://confluence.lumiclabs.internal/display/browse/display/6a09a20a

### Nightfill Scheduler — Release Runbook (fragment)

Before promoting the Nightfill scheduler build, confirm that all pending backfill windows for the Corvette Lake dataset have drained. Verify the cron shards report idle, then freeze the queue for no more than ten minutes. Tag the candidate, run the replay smoke test against the staging warehouse, and have a second engineer confirm checksums. The artifact must be signed prior to upload; use the key below for the signing step.

signing key of hawif-yawig = bky3_wie

### Deploy Step 6 — Parceline webhook configuration

For this week's sync: the Parceline tracking webhook moves to the new ingest tier on Thursday. Update `parceline.env` on each ingest node before the cutover. Set `PL_WEBHOOK_PATH` to `/v2/track` and `PL_RETRY_MAX` to 6, matching the values agreed at last sprint review.

The webhook validates incoming payloads against a shared signing credential, which must be present in the same file. Add it on the next line:

env line for fafof-fahag: LEDGER_TOKEN5=f8790

## Recovering a locked plugin account — Stockline Reconciler

Hey plugin folks — if the nightly inventory reconciliation job fails three times in a row, Stockline automatically suspends your plugin's service account to protect the ledger. Don't panic; your data is fine and no counts are lost.

To recover, first check the job log for the failing SKU batch and clear any malformed rows. Then head to the partner console and choose Reinstate Account. You'll be prompted for a recovery passphrase at that point, so enter the one shown just below.

unlock words, fajof-kahip: ulaath-zorael-drumir